Fayette, Iowa Fayette is a city in Fayette County, Iowa, in the United States. As of the 2010 census, the city population was 1,338. It was named after the Marquis de la Fayette, French hero of the American Revolutionary War. Fayette is the home of Upper Iowa University, a small private college (...) Alexander-Dickman Hall Alexander-Dickman Hall, formerly known as Old Sem, Old Main, and College Hall, is a historic building located on the campus of Upper Iowa University in Fayette, Iowa, United States. It was the first building built for the college, and for a number of years it was its only building (...)
